“She doesn’t like us.” Tarasova called Duhamel’s comments about the CAS decision on the bronze medal in the 2022 Olympic team tournament unfair

Honored Coach of the USSR in Figure Skating Tatiana Tarasova called Megan Duhamel’s comments unfair, as she was dissatisfied with the CAS decision to keep the bronze medal in the team tournament of the 2022 Olympic Games for Russian athletes.

Canadian 2018 Olympic champion Megan Duhamel, who has repeatedly criticized Russian athletes, said the Canadian team should receive bronze at the awards ceremony on August 7 in Paris.

“She doesn’t like us, it’s understandable. But she’s an athlete and her words are unfair. In all respects, we are third, period,” Tarasova told .

On Friday, CAS announced that it had rejected the Canadian side’s appeal against the results of the figure skating team competition at the 2022 Olympic Games. The Russian athletes retained their bronze medals.

The Russian team won the team tournament, but after Kamila Valieva was disqualified for an anti-doping rule violation, the results of the competition were revised. The International Skating Union (ISU), after canceling Valieva’s results, placed the American team in first place, the Japanese team in second place, and the Russian team was supposed to receive bronze. Team Canada, which placed fourth, also claimed third place by filing an appeal with CAS against the ISU decision.

As a result, the American team took first place in the tournament with 65 points, the Japanese team (63) took second place, and the Russian team (54) took third place. Valieva, Mark Kondratyuk, Anastasia Mishina and Alexander Gallyamov, Victoria Sinitsina and Nikita Katsalapov performed for the Russian team in Beijing.
